Transaction 8e58701b15e49f5a4ed43ca7633b536df4cf6098021265e593f0bb94ccbf6237
2 Input
2 Outputs
- 8e58701b15e49f5a4ed43ca7633b536df4cf6098021265e593f0bb94ccbf6237:0
- 8e58701b15e49f5a4ed43ca7633b536df4cf6098021265e593f0bb94ccbf6237:1
value 29980655
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
value 9993215
address 37g9xL98FJdgrmJ9nPM7kTDZkwDeyJoEXz